Cranberry Sauce Meatballs: A Sweet and Spicy Crowd-Pleaser

Cranberry Sauce Meatballs are a sweet and spicy appetizer perfect for any gathering.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 25 minutes
Total Time 35 minutes
Servings: 6 meatballs
Course: Appetizers
Cuisine: American
Calories: 250

Ingredients
  

For the Sauce
  • 1 cup Cranberry Sauce use homemade for a fresher taste
  • 1/2 cup Brown Sugar use less for a less sweet profile or substitute with a sugar alternative
  • 1 tablespoon Chili Powder can replace with smoked paprika for a different flavor
  • 1 teaspoon Cumin omit if not liked or substitute with curry powder
  • 1/4 teaspoon Cayenne Pepper adjust quantity based on spice tolerance
For the Meatballs
  • 1 pound Fully Cooked Meatballs substitute with turkey meatballs or vegetarian varieties if desired

Equipment

  • medium saucepan

Method
 

Step‑by‑Step Instructions
  1. In a medium saucepan, combine cranberry sauce, brown sugar, chili powder, cumin, and cayenne pepper over medium heat. Stir gently and cook for about 5 minutes until it simmers.
  2. Add fully cooked meatballs into the pan. Toss gently to coat the meatballs in the sauce for 2-3 minutes.
  3. Cover the saucepan and reduce heat to low, letting the meatballs simmer for about 20 minutes. Stir occasionally.
  4. Serve warm, garnished with fresh parsley or sesame seeds. Enjoy with toothpicks!

Notes

These meatballs can be prepared a day in advance and heated before serving.
